New Delhi, March 21 -- Employability for new-age jobs requiring technical, cognitive and language skills in India is merely 1.7 per cent on an average, according to a report.

According to Aspiring Minds National Employability Report, only 3.84 pc of engineers have the technical, cognitive and language skills required for software related job in start-ups. Additionally, a mere 3 pc engineers have new-age technological skills in areas like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ning, Data Science and Mobile Development. On aggregate, the employability for new-age jobs is on average 1.7 pc.
